java.lang.Object
oracle.calendar.soap.client.authentication.BasicAuth
Provides basic authentication services. The username and password are passed plaintext within a SOAP header of a SOAP request. This mechanism is not secure and should be used for development and testing purposes.
If BasicAuth is to be used in a production environment, the SSL protocol should be used to secure the HTTP connection between the SOAP client and Calendar Web services host.

| Method Summary | |
org.w3c.dom.Element |
getElement()Returns a new XML DOM structure representing the BasicAuth SOAP header to be transmitted to the Calendar Web service. |
void |
setName(java.lang.String in_name)Specifies the user name. |
void |
setPassword(java.lang.String in_password)Specifies the user's password. |
